PostHeaderIcon Decorative Pillows Use As Home Decor Items

Home decor and interior design demands a lot of expert attention and we all have a different tastes and desires when we hanker after decorating our new house. All rooms and areas in the house have its own importance; however, living room is such place which really needs your focused attention when going to decorate it. Along with many other decorative items for the living room, decorative pillow play a key role to doll up it charmingly and gorgeously.

Let us have a look at the new styles and designs of decorative pillows for your living room.
For a decorative purpose, usually you have square and rectangle shaped pillows.
Also you can have bolsters to add more appeal. Tasseled and corded Tuscany decorative pillow gives an elegant and attractive look to your living room. They are available in many different designs, what you merely need to do is pick up those gorgeous decorative pillows with the color that match up with your interior decoration and the color of the seating arrangement. Sometimes the contrast colors decorative pillows hugely compliment your sofas.

Tasseled earth tone and other natural color pillows provide a sophistication and chic style to a modern interior decoration. Look at the material that is used for making the pillow. That is really very important. A soft touch is what everyone look for. Make sure that the pillows you have selected have exceptional softness and suppleness.

Also pay attention to the fill of the pillows. If you look for a little more firmness, foam filled decorative pillows give you the effect you look for; however most of the time you want to have that extra softness for your living room pillows. If it so, feather and down decorative pillows will do that wonderful job of giving soft touch and limberness to your living area seating arrangement.

Bolsters are certainly an unavoidable choice for living room decoration. The elegance and majestic ambiance offered by the bolsters cannot be found anywhere else. However, if you don’t have a traditional interior style for your living room, it may, sometimes, look a little odd for the living space. If at all you want to buy bolsters, make sure that it goes well with your modern interior decor and style. Fortunately, the bolsters too have evolved and you get them in modern styles and designs.

Last but not least, the size of the decorative pillows! Decide on the size of the pillow. Sometime the oversize decorative pillows really give a lot of appeal to your living space. It depends on the other decorative item and the ability of the decorative pillow to gel with other decorative home accessories. If you don’t hire an interior designer to decor your home, you need to pay attention to such small things to make it better and attractive.

PostHeaderIcon No More Water Damage in Your Basement

There are plenty of things that are going to go wrong in your home over the years, and the effects from these things will be measured on very different scales. Some issues that you may have around your home may be found to be quite tolerable, while other things are will not be. When it comes to water damage, especially in the basement, there should be no room for tolerance. If you have water damage in your basement, it can begin to deteriorate the very foundation of your home. It can also cause health issues related to mold issues if the water is allowed to remain for a period of time. This best thing to do is remove the water from your basement and address the issue once and for all.

A basement can be a wonderful thing to have, and they are getting to be something of a rarity in the housing market these days because builders don’t want to spend the extra money it takes to build homes with basements. There are many benefits to having a basement. They are an excellent space for storage and if you finish them out, they can be a great addition to the living space of your home. Another amazing benefit of a basement that many people are getting to realize all too well is that they provide more safety during a severe storm that includes high winds and tornadoes than other rooms that are above ground. With all of these appealing characteristics that a basement has, there are some problems that can come with them as well. Basements are located below ground, which means that they are vulnerable to the excessive moisture in the earth surrounding them if they are not sealed well. Basements are also the lowest point of your home, which means that if issues with water damage occur in other areas of the home such as flooding, the basement is going to be effected because the water will naturally flow downward to the lowest point in your home. These problems can steer a home owner away from wanting a basement very quickly if they are having issues such as these. However, if you have a basement that is experiencing issues related with water, this is no time to give up. There are some great solutions to help you rid your basement of water issues that have proven to be very effective.

Before you can really get to the root of the problem that is causing the water issues in your basement, you need to extract the water and get the area good and dry so that you can get things done the right way. Water extraction can be done with the aid of a pump that is designed to suck up the water and relocate it utilizing tubing. Once this has been accomplished, a vacuum designed to help dry wet areas can be used to remove any water that was left behind from the pump. With the area completely dry and free of any clutter, you can seal the floor and walls with chemicals that are designed to provide a strong moisture barrier so that water cannot come back in. If you see any cracks or holes, be sure to fill them first before the sealer is applied. Once this is done you should have a more secure area that you can now utilize much more. Regardless of how hard you work to get your basement dry and clean, it will only stay that way if you have done what is necessary to allow for proper draining around your home and ensured that there are no issues with water leaks inside the home with things such as old or faulty plumbing.

One more thing that you should consider that is a great way to prepare for the worst is install a pump in your basement that will automatically turn on if water is detected. It is better to be safe than sorry and by installing one of these popular pumps, you are ensuring that if water does find it’s way in, you are doing what you can to quickly direct it right back out.

PostHeaderIcon Home Remodeling Estimates and What You Need To Know

home remodeling

Thinking of tackling those lengthy to do lists? Let’s see here. Change the lightbulb in the overhead light; done. Pull the weeds from the garden; no sweat. Pull up the carpeting in the living room and replace it with hardwood flooring…wait, run that by me again? There are some tasks around the house that are easy, simple even and require little to no time or effort and then there are thoses that we may need to consider having a professional brought in. One of the perfect examples of this scenario is when it comes to home remodeling.

Just saying those two words together in a sentence is enough to strike fear into the hearts of many a home owner. But why? The changes themselves should bring nothing but joy, after all we are the ones that want the changes made. They would be completed to our specifications, the end result being a realization of something that formerly existed only in dreams. So just what makes home remodeling a scary prospect?

The fear in this case is more of sticker shock when it comes to home remodeling costs. Everywhere we look we see nothing but dollars signs and open hands looking for more money. We physically feel the drain on our pocket books and every time we open the mailbox, a feeling of nausea spreads through us like the plague. There is a way to stop these worries at the start. Three little words…home remodeling estimates.

Home remodeling estimates are a key part to the remodeling process. How so? First and foremost, they provide us with an insiders glimpse at what the end cost for all the upgrades or additions we are trying to complete will be thus allowing us a certain piece of mind throughout the process. Secondly, having this information readily available aids us in making an educated decision as to which service or contractor will accomplish our goals in the most economical fashion while it also allows us to fit the service provider with the budget we have in mind so we can get the most for our money.

Last but not least, if by chance we over budgetted on a project or goodness forbid under budgetted, we can find the holes in our plans before we have reached the point of no return. After all, no one wants only half a room finished when the goal is to complete the whole.

Stepping outside of budgeted goals is where most home remodeling plans go wrong. Take a moment to consider what you and your family are comfortable paying and set your remodeling budget accordingly. Allow yourself the time to gather home remodeling estimates from a few sources to make certain that you are getting the best value, best quality and best service to meet your needs. Once the dream and the reality are in line with one another, achieving an end result that you can take pride in for years to come will that much easier.
